I would recommend buying good quality component cables like the official sony ps3 component cables or monster. There are some other cheaper ones on amazon that do not have as good shielding but honestly the difference between those and monster or official sony isn't that noticeable on my tv. Your tv might be different.

If you don't want to want to buy an expensive OSSC or Framemeister, then maybe you can try a cheap component to HDMI converter. I've never tried them. It might do the job for you. The problem I've always seen with these devices is that most of them just upscale, they don't allow a pass thru of just 480i/480p.

Also, if you want to take the PS2 a step forward is get a memory card with FreeMcboot off of ebay and add ps2rdmod which will let you run most PS2 games in 16:9 with patching files called .pnach.
